>>> The bitstream filters do not work with merged in side data
>>>
>>> This leaves the input packet split if it is being split.
>>> It could be merged again, if thats preferred ? That would involve
>>> an extra malloc and memcpy though
>>
>> Since side data is being split and merged at a latter point during
>> av_interleaved_write_frame() and av_write_frame() calls, maybe we
>> could just move the relevant code before the autobsf kicks in.
>>
>> See attached patch. FATE passes and the sample from ticket 5927
>> works with autobsf, same as with your patch.
>> It doesn't change ffmpeg.c manual bsf's behavior, though. For that
>> your commit from yesterday is still needed.
